ok so what do you know i pull the belts and it cranks!!! The only pulley that doesnt spin is the one next to the harmonic balance to the right. This would be the one at the bottom. It would be in line with the coils if you were looking down from the hood. What is it?
 


Get a new one.

You'll need to have it discharged by a shop. Then you can either swap it out for a new compressor, a reman'd compressor, or an AC pulley delete. The delete takes the compressor and replaces it with a single idler pulley...so no AC.

Cheapest way I've seen (my AC comp is ****ed too) is to get a reman'd compressor, get a shop to discharge the system, and then install the compressor yourself. Then charge the system.
 


Umm...you have to have a shop discharge it. You wont be able to, plus theres a massive fine if you get caught doing so.

Should be about $200 for a compressor, and nothing for labor since you'll be doing that.
Shop shouldnt charge much to discharge it.

And you cant really run much without that belt on...cause that's on the Alternator, Water pump, and power steering pump too...
